The verb "to contain" can be synonymous with "hold" or "enclose" or simply "have".
Examples : "The bulb contains (has) a filament". "The case contains (encloses) the parts of the computer." "The beaker contains (holds) the liquid chemical."
Synonyms for the noun container could include - package, storage, or vessel.
